Abstract
AbstractThe present work is dedicated to the determination of the Gurney velocity of the unconventional aluminum‐water explosive. The paper presents the experimental arrangement, the diagnostic equipment used, and the main results that have been obtained. The experiments report the accurate velocity measurement of projectiles accelerated by aluminum and copper underwater exploding wires. Based on the results obtained, a Gurney velocity of 1.88 km/s has been obtained for the unconventional aluminum‐water explosive. The result is discussed and compared with typical values for standard explosives.
